  • Priseltsi - Burgas Province (Bulgarian: Приселци) is a village in South- East Bulgaria, situated in Obshtina Nessebar, in the Burgas region. Priseltsi is an 8km/10 minute drive from the town of Obzor, a seaside town with much development in progress. It is known for its clean fresh air, rural freedom, clear night skies and unique wildlife and nature. There are quite a few newly built, modern houses and some older ones in need of repair. A small church has been built and paid for by the local inhabitants, most of which are elderly and all of which are warm and kind-hearted. Pavements are currently being upgraded at the north end of the village. There is one small shop/café which is only open on certain days and there are always plenty of farm animals running free around the village. A cultural centre has been opened at the north end of the village - its expected to run traditional folk dancing evening and various outdoor activities. There is a small path through a forest on the North-Western side of the village which takes you through sunflower fields, over a bridge and straight into the neighbouring village of Popovich.
